Launch of the book “Génération Canal Famille”

A whole generation was marked by Canal Famille, the youth channel which offered daring series such as In a galaxy near you, Radio Enfer and Télé-Pirate.
Youth programs Bibi and Geneviève, The Intrepid and Pin-Pon were also launched on Canal Famille, born in 1988. Well-known actors who are still in the business have taken their first steps there or have made a remarkable passage there, such as Michel Charette, François Chénier, Guy Jodoin, Claude Legault, Joël Legendre, Élyse Marquis and Sophie Prégent, to name a few.
To trace this rich history, Simon Portelance and Guy A. St Cyr offer the book Family Channel Generation, published by Québec Amérique and whose launch took place on Monday evening in the presence, in particular, of Jean-François Beaupré, Vincent Bolduc, Sophie Dansereau, Daniel Dõ, Guy Jodoin, Élyse Marquis, Yves Soutière and Gilbert Turp.
Abundantly illustrated and containing several interviews, Family Channel Generation is the genesis of the shows and it will certainly take fans back to their childhood or their adolescence.
Since January 2001, Canal Famille has been replaced by VRAK.TV.
